They protect the mainland from storms and waves, and protect tidal lagoons which serve as nurseries for a variety of fish and shellfish. Instead, the act that created the system limits the Federal financial assistance for development related activities such as spending for roads, wastewater systems, potable water supply, and disaster relief, NOAA explains. Though it has long been assumed that this erosion was due to the area's rapid rate of relative sea level rise, recent studies by the U.S. Geological Survey show that other coastal processes, such as the longshore redistribution of sediments, are responsible for this erosion. Although most images we see of barrier islands after hurricanes show beaten-up swaths of land, barrier islands often get replenished as a hurricane moves through. Building hard infrastructure such as homes, roads and hotels on barrier islands interrupts their lateral migration. Barrier beaches, barrier islands, and barrier spits differ from similar features in that barriers tend to be parallel to, but separated from, the mainland by a lagoon, estuary, or bay. Padre Island is the longest barrier island in the world, and lies off the coast of mainland Texas in the Gulf of Mexico.
